PT Rubrics Vision Board

This document outlines criteria for exceeding, meeting, approaching, or not meeting standards on a project. It includes five criteria: inclusion of required areas, relevance of images, inclusion of key words, comprehensive coverage of identified goals, and understanding of goals. Points are assigned on a 20-15-10-5 scale depending on how well the project meets each criterion.
